Mtume Gant is a Director and Actor hailing from New York City. A Graduate of the Laguardia H.S. of the Performing Arts as well as the Acting Conservatory at Suny Purchase Mtume began his career as an Actor staring in films like the Sundance Award winning Hurricane Streets (1997), Carlito's Way Rise to Power (2005) and maybe most notably as a cast member in the HBO series OZ. Since those days Mtume has gone on to become an award winning Filmmaker after debuting his first short film SPIT (2015) and is in development of his fist Feature Film Project.
